Braun Syncro

I use a Braun electric shaver and am very satisfied. The foils last a long time - typically 1+ years. I never got more than 6 months out of my Remington before the foils needed replacing.

This one has a "cleaning station" that rinses the head in some alcohol based stuff - good cleaning job + sanitary. I've had far less razor-attributable rashes using that cleaner.

The manual suggests you clean it every day - bah, I say. Every Friday after shaving - that has been good enough, and the cleaning solution lasts for several months that way.

When I was first shaving, I had a real problem with irritation on my neck. Remington makes a powder stick that has the properties of baby powder, without the "cutsie" smell. Rub that on your neck and face and the shaver glides smoothly with little or no irritation.

As others have indicated, most people eventually get used to the friction of an electric razor. I know I did.

I do shave with a blade (Atra or something similar) about once a week - usually on Sunday night in the shower to trim off 2 days worth of growth over the weekend. With the blade, I don't need to shave again until Tuesday morning. With the electric razor, I have to shave in the evening if I'm going out and need to look presentable.
